A rough model of the College Football Playoff Trophy.
This was made using rough dimensional matching to get approximate angles and distances of the trophy. There are few to no other models available to work off of, so this is the best I could do. If anyone has a better model or knows how to do dimensional matching well, please have at it in a remix!
The current version was designed for a single-color printer and is meant to print in 4 parts and pieced together. If anyone wants a solid model or is one that is better optimized for a multi-extrusion printer, leave a note in the comments.
The STL files are supposed to be the size of the original, though there is discrepancy on whether just the measurements quoted by the committee being the top part or the whole trophy including the base. The overall trophy should be roughly proportional though
The example print shown in the pictures is at 25% scale.
